Transaction 18e6882596f3e18a857e4dc4d44feba2a5a0823f53f8c2a9ec9cd9ecd4a408b9

1 Input
2 Outputs
  • 18e6882596f3e18a857e4dc4d44feba2a5a0823f53f8c2a9ec9cd9ecd4a408b9:0
  • value  4050074018
    address  1kWxL9YYyB1bjMpKBsrQXcndouUhz5hHV
  • 18e6882596f3e18a857e4dc4d44feba2a5a0823f53f8c2a9ec9cd9ecd4a408b9:1
  • value  1515000000
    address  3CNScBdcC9D39C1amvSMjtDJkTCQUaJhg2